A intensive two day course, following on from the 7 week beginners course.

The focus of the first day will be the fitted bodice block, which is the basis of so many designs, from tops and shirts to dresses and jackets. After drafting a standard size, students will develop their own size and create a toile, and then will explore dart manipulation and other adaptations.

As the course progresses we will look to use our five blocks to create different styles and add more options to our skill set. Options will include different sleeves, skirt styles, design lines, pockets and looking at styles individual students wish to develop...

Participants must have completed the beginner pattern making course with Jo. For participants that have prior experience or those who have completed courses elsewhere, please contact our office to arrange to speak with Jo to discuss your skill set before enrolling to ensure this course is suitable for you.
